流体工学 終末速度 ホームページプログラミング 


非線形方程式を逐次代入法で解く。 termvel.html

スクリプト部分の記述

(VBScript の式の部分)
 <script language="VBScript"><!--
Dim dpm,dp,rof,rop,mu,ZEP,ZX0,NL,X,ZX1,ZX2,ZXD,ZX3,Rep,vt,CR,G
Sub A_onClick
dpm=Valdpm.value
dp=dpm/1000
Valdp.value=dp
rof=Valrof.value
rop=Valrop.value
mu=Valmu.value
NL =1 
ZEP = .000001
ZX0=100
ZXD=1
Do While ABS(ZXD) > ZEP
X = ZX0
velocity
ZX1 = G
X = ZX1
velocity
ZX2 = G
ZXD = ZX2 - 2 * ZX1 + ZX0
ZX3 = ZX2
ZX3 = ZX0 - (ZX1 - ZX0) * (ZX1 - ZX0) / ZXD
ZX0 = ZX3
NL=NL+1
Loop
Valvt.value=ZX3
ValRep.value=Rep
ValNL.value=NL
End Sub
Sub velocity
vt=X
Rep=vt*dp*rof/mu
If Rep>0.035 Then
CR=(0.55+4.8/(Rep^0.5))^2
Else
CR=24/Rep
End If
G=(4*9.807*dp*(rop-rof)/(3*rof*CR))^0.5
End Sub
--></script> 

 


inserted by FC2 system